How do I find independent living near me?
Start by narrowing your search to a location, by distance from family, climate, or a familiar town, then set a realistic monthly budget. Use online directories and your state's senior services agency to build a list, and confirm each community is licensed and in good standing. Tour at least three, eat a meal there, and talk with current residents about daily life, fees, and management. Ask what's included, how often prices rise, and what happens if care needs change. What should I compare between nearby communities?
Look beyond the brochure. Compare the all-in monthly fee and exactly what it covers, apartment sizes and floor plans, dining quality and meal flexibility, and amenities like fitness, transportation, and social programming. Check the contract type, any entrance fee, and the history of annual rate increases. Note whether assisted living or memory care is available on campus in case needs grow. Visit at different times to gauge the real atmosphere and staff friendliness. Read recent reviews and inspection records.
